According to court documents, prosecutors said Rukstales was part of a group that followed police who were retreating down a stairwell in the Capitol, with surveillance footage showing chairs tumbling down the stairs behind them. Some of them threw chairs and hurled unknown substances at the officers, and officers could be seen on video surveillance retreating down a flight of stairs and escalators toward the Capitol Visitors Center, as chairs tumbled down the stairs behind them. A former Inverness tech executive was sentenced Friday to 30 days behind bars for his role in the Jan. 6 attack on the U.S. Capitol that has evolved into the largest criminal investigation in the countrys history.
